Oil Change: A Crucial Maintenance Step

One of the most common and necessary maintenance tasks for your vehicle is an oil change. Oil is essential for lubricating your engine parts and preventing wear and tear. Over time, oil becomes less effective and can lead to engine damage. Regular oil changes, typically every 3,000 to 5,000 miles, help maintain the engine’s performance and longevity, making it one of the most important services for your vehicle’s health.

Tire Maintenance: Ensuring Safe Driving

Your vehicle’s tires are crucial for safety, and regular tire maintenance is vital to avoid accidents and ensure smooth driving. This includes rotating tires regularly to ensure even wear, checking tire pressure to prevent over or under-inflation, and replacing tires that are worn out. Balancing tires and aligning the wheels also help maintain optimal handling and reduce strain on other parts of the vehicle.

Brake Inspection: Safety First

Brakes are one of the most critical safety features of your vehicle. Regular brake inspections are necessary to ensure that the brake pads are not worn down and that the braking system is functioning properly. Failing to maintain your brakes can lead to reduced stopping power, increasing the risk of accidents. Whether it’s replacing brake pads, repairing brake lines, or checking the brake fluid, a thorough inspection can prevent serious issues.

Battery Check: Avoiding Unexpected Breakdowns

A well-functioning battery is essential for starting your vehicle and powering electrical systems. Regular battery checks, which include cleaning terminals, checking the charge, and replacing old batteries, can help you avoid unexpected breakdowns. It’s particularly important to have your battery checked before extreme weather conditions, as hot or cold temperatures can impact its performance.

Transmission Services: Smooth Shifting for Longevity

The transmission system in your vehicle is responsible for transferring power from the engine to the wheels. Regular transmission maintenance is necessary to avoid costly repairs. This includes checking and replacing transmission fluid, inspecting for leaks, and ensuring the transmission operates smoothly. Neglecting transmission care can lead to shifting problems, slipping gears, or even total transmission failure.

Alignment and Suspension: A Smooth Ride

Proper alignment and suspension services ensure a smooth and comfortable ride. Misalignment or issues with your suspension can lead to uneven tire wear, poor handling, and increased fuel consumption. Mechanics can check and adjust the alignment to prevent these problems, ensuring that your vehicle drives straight and true on the road.
